12 details you missed during this year's Met Gala

<p class="ingestion featured-caption">The 2024 Met Gala was filled with stars, from Zendaya to Doja Cat. Aliah Anderson/Getty Images;Theo Wargo/GA/The Hollywood Reporter via Getty Images</p><ul class="summary-list"><li><strong>Many stars attended the "Sleeping Beauties: Reawakening Fashion" </strong><a target="_blank" rel href="https://www.businessinsider.com/met-gala"><strong>Met Gala</strong></a><strong> on Monday.</strong></li><li>Zendaya had two looks and Tyla's look incorporated real sand. </li></ul><p>On Monday, dozens of celebrities descended upon the steps of the Metropolitan Museum of Art for <a target="_blank" href="https://www.businessinsider.com/best-dressed-met-gala-red-carpet-looks-ranked-2024-5">this year's Met Gala</a> — "Sleeping Beauties: Reawakening Fashion."</p><p>The night's dress code is "The Garden of Time," inspired by a short story by J.G. Ballard.</p><p>And although the outfits come with a high price tag, attending the Met Gala also isn't cheap — <a target="_blank" href="https://www.harpersbazaar.com/uk/fashion/a36092219/met-gala-theme/">tickets</a> for this year's Met Gala cost about $35,000 each, and entire tables can cost up to $300,000.</p><p>Here are some details from the night you may have missed.</p>
